4.0 out of 5 stars Succinct and Informative, 11 Jun 2003
By A Customer - Published on Amazon.com
This review is from: Keys to Reading an Annual Report (Barron's Business Keys) (Paperback)
This book is very succinct and the explanations for each accounting concepts are very easy to understand and easy to remember. The "Red Flags" after each concept are very useful in pointing out all the possible problems that may arise. While the strengths of this book is his conciseness, it does require you to have some basic accounting background. Otherwise, some of the explanations may seem confusing. Having said that, if i am reading an annual report, I would definitely want to have this book beside me. Happy reading!

5.0 out of 5 stars Keys to Reading an Annual Report, 29 Dec 2001
By G. Fieo - Published on Amazon.com
This review is from: Keys to Reading an Annual Report (Barron's Business Keys) (Paperback)
This small manual concisely and succinctly presents the major elements of financial statements in easy to read, line-by-line format. It is not only ideal for the average investor without an accounting background, but also for the accountant who needs to explain financial statement concepts and presentations to others. Its examples are easy to relate to and quite illustrative. I regret this wasn't available when I tried to decipher "Accounting 101".
